I first came across the Arduboy when I watched Short Circuit's video about the Arduboy Mini, and I was in awe of the super cool device it is. As a fun weekend project, I put together an Arduboy on a protoboard, and after playing on the very janky-looking protoboard for a while, I decided to make a PCB for it which I call the ArduGame.
The ArduGame uses an Arduino Pro Micro as its microcontroller, and an SH1106 1.3" SPI OLED as its screen. Additionally, there's a TP4056 LiPo manager along with a 3.3V to 5V step-up converter (MT3608). I've designed the ArduGame to be powered by a 3.3V LiPo battery
To be able to upload game files (in the .ino file format) download MrBlinky's Arduboy-homemade-package and upload your favorite game!
